#scanweb.rb
#用法rubyscanweb.rbwww.ythuaji.com.cn 將當前結果保存在c:\1.txt
require'net/http'
filename=File.new('c:\1.txt',"w+")
if$*[0]==nil
puts"hehe,沒有輸入網址"
else
h=Net::HTTP.new($*[0],80)
resp,data=h.get('/index.html',nil)
ifresp.message=="OK"
data.scan(/
putsx
filename.putsx
end
end
end
#無聊,有vbs、php、ruby版了,好像ruby比vbs快,與php不相上下。
=begin
修改一下
require'net/http'
filename=File.new('1.txt',"w+")
if$*[0]==nil
abort"用法示例:ruby#$0www.sohu.com ,結果放在當前目錄1.txt"
end
h=Net::HTTP.new($*[0],80)
resp,data=h.get('/index.html',nil)
ifresp.message=="OK"
data.scan(/
putsx
filename.putsx
end
end
=end